Those Good Feelings – Yoni

Here we go! A brand new Yoni track, and it’s amazing. You truly need to wait for this one to get at least a minute in – when the track starts picking up, it’s fire. My only disappointment in this track is that it’s only 3 minutes long. Yoni, you could easily make this a five minute plus track without losing any of the energy you’ve built up. I look forward to Those Good Feelings v.2! Take a listen, download, and if you’re in Texas this week, be sure to come party with Yoni and Shwayze!

        Left on Freeport – Crystal Seth Free Mixtape

        I love seeing young artists keep to their grind and continuously improve, track over track, to finally release a Kollection-worthy mixtape. Here’s Crystal Seth’s Left on Freeport – his latest mixtape released today on Datpiff, sponsored by The Kollection. I really enjoy this young artist’s style – he’s laid back, relaxed, and actually shakes up his style with each track. His instrumentals are varied, each track tells a different story, and his videos are always entertaining. I’ve featured three of my favorites off this tape above, but don’t miss the entire download at Datpiff.

                      Put It In Your Manners (Childish Gambino x Chiddy Bang) – DJ 21azy

                      After reading some of the comments on various posts, I felt it was necessary to get away from those electro mashups. To me, and I know for The K as well, the responses and input from the readers is extremely valuable. With this input, I thought it was necessary to give you guys this dope mashup by DJ 21azy.

                      This one, titled Put It In Your Manners, samples the vocals of Gambino’s Put It In My Video and is laid on top of Chiddy Bang’s Mind Your Manners. I’ve always loved the chorus (the high-pitched childlike vocals) of Chiddy’s song as well as the beat done by Xaphoon. The Gambino track I had never heard of, but once again, Gambino demonstrates his skills as a lyricist. The culmination of these artists into one song results in a fun and upbeat mashup.
